About the Role

This role is worksite-based on an Offshore Oil & Gas Platform and provides tactical operational HSE support and subject matter expertise to the site-based leadership and work teams around risks involving rigging, scaffolding, rope and welding works. As a Casual HSE Advisor, you will cover staff leave on a rotating shift working in tandem with an opposite shift HSE Advisors.

Roster: 2 weeks offshore

Hours: 12-hour days, 2 weeks on / 2 weeks off roster

Duration: 6 months

Key Responsibilities

  • Provide technical advice on HSE systems, processes, standards, legislative requirements, and risk management principles to all levels of personnel within the project.
  • Use the One HSE Culture Program to build HSE capability in Site/Project Teams and embed continuous improvement principles to optimize HSE outcomes.
  • Maintain and report on monthly safety performance statistics, identify trends, and recommend corrective actions.
  • Incident Management & Audit facilitation
  • Ensure effective shift handover between rotating shift HSE Advisors

About You / Requirements

  • Diploma in Work Health and Safety (WHS)
  • Current Provide First Aid Certificate & Construction White Card
  • Formal qualifications in Incident Investigation techniques (Taproot / ICAM)
  • 3-5 years’ experience in Offshore oil and gas projects
  • Exposure to heavy industrial environments and processes with Demolition or Decommissioning experience highly regarded
